Man airlifted after Snowmobile accident on Bailey’s Lake

VIRGINIA, Minn. — A man was airlifted to Duluth after a snowmobile accident in Virginia.

According to officials, on Wednesday at around 2:18 a.m., officers responded to a report of an unknown problem near Bailey’s Lake.

The caller said that they saw a bright light and heard what they thought was a generator running.

When officers arrived, they found a 41-year-old man lying around 20 feet away from a running snowmobile.

Crews began to render aid, and the man was taken to a nearby hospital in Virginia and then airlifted to Duluth.

Officials say that the accident took place around 75 yards out on the lake.

At this time, there are no updates on his condition.
